Meadow Refresh Each Season (Everdell)
Everdell forums often recommend more frequent meadow refreshes to reduce dead turns and boost card flow.
Whenever a player prepares for season, discard and refill one Meadow card before their next turn.
Open Event Draft (Everdell)
This Everdell setup rule increases strategic planning by giving players early influence over event race conditions.
Reveal 6 event cards at setup. In reverse order, each player bans one. Play with the remaining 4.
Trailing Worker Bonus (Everdell)
A catch-up Everdell variant helps players behind on city growth maintain tempo into late seasons.
If your city has 3+ fewer cards than leader at season prep, gain one temporary worker for that season only.
2-Player Shared Occupancy Token (Everdell)
Two-player Everdell can feel open; this house rule increases competition for premium locations.
In 2-player mode, place one neutral occupancy token on a basic location each season.
Kids Open-Hand First Season (Everdell)
Families teaching Everdell often reveal hands in spring to explain card combos and seasonal timing.
During first season only, keep hands face up and allow table coaching. Return to normal hidden hands afterward.
